One teen treated for gunshot wounds and released from hospital following the incident 

ATASCADERO — On Sunday, Jan. 1, at approximately 3:28 a.m. Atascadero Police officers responded to the 9100 block of Las Lomas Avenue regarding a female teen reporting her ex-boyfriend was sending her threatening messages. 

According to APD, officers checked the area and were unable to locate the teen suspect. While continuing their search, officers heard a number of shots being fired in the area of the juvenile victim’s residence. 

Officers could not determine if a shooting had actually occurred but obtained descriptions of two male teens seen running from the area. A short time later an officer observed two male teens in the 9100 block of El Camino Real, matching the description of the two seen running from the area of the original shots fired location. The two teens fled on foot from the officer. After officers pursued the teens, one of the teens surrendered and officers confirmed he was the suspect sending the threatening messages earlier that evening.

During the pursuit of the teens, APD was notified of the SLO County Sheriff’s Office enroute to Twin Cities Hospital regarding a gunshot wound victim. An Atascadero officer responded and contacted the teen victim, who stated he had been shot while sitting in a vehicle near the address on Las Lomas Avenue after visiting the above-mentioned residence. The victim was treated for several gunshot wounds and was ultimately released from the hospital. 

Atascadero Police detectives and crime scene unit were called in to conduct the investigation. A K9 from the California Department of Fish and Wildlife, trained in the detection of firearms, was requested to assist with the search of the area the teen suspect was apprehended. A firearm was recovered. 

Authorities reported the suspect was transported and booked at San Luis Obispo County Juvenile Services for attempted homicide. 

Atascadero Police Investigations Unit stated they will conduct a follow up investigation on the incident.
